Location : Tân Quang, Văn Lâm, Hưng Yên, Vietnam
Application technology : no soot by full combustion, enabling full- combustion of low-quality pallets
Deployment plan : install 10 units in paper, textile, food, and building factories by the end of 2023
Maximize the use of waste wood
Previously, the material for pallets was limited to the inner part of waste wood, but APULLPOWER technology utilizes all parts of waste wood, including bark, as materials for pallets.

Palletization of variety of
waste materials
Previously, by-product materials were not available as pellet material, but APULLPOWER technology can be applied to a wide range of food source wastes such as chaff, coffee grounds, etc.
